Kent German Kent German, Senior Editor April 14, 2009

Samsung is never one to rest on its laurels. While some manufacturers put out a mere trickle of new cell phones, Samsung always has a deluge of handsets. Trade shows are no exception, of course, and the company had a big presence at the CTIA show in Las Vegas where it introduced a handful of new handsets. One of these new devices, the Samsung Impression, impressed us (sorry) so much that we named it as our top phone of the show. Indeed, the messaging phone offers a brilliant display, an intuitive design, and a hefty load of multimedia features. After a thorough review, we ranked it as one of the best AT&T phones we've seen this year. Samsung also introduced the Samsung Propel Pro for AT&T. As Bonnie Cha found, it is a capable Windows Mobile device, but its bulky design makes it less appealing than AT&T's other messaging smartphones. The Samsung TwoStep for MetroPCS wasn't introduced at CTIA, but we just got the opportunity to check it out. Though its controls were a tad cramped and the call quality wasn't spectacular, it would make a great starter music phone. The Samsung SGH-T119 made its first appearance at CES 2009, too. It's a quality basic phone, but only for occasional use.
